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
Carefully cut the lobster tails in half lengthwise using kitchen shears or a sharp knife. Gently lift the meat to rest on the top of the shell for easy grilling.
In a small bowl, combine olive oil, salt, and black pepper. Brush the mixture generously over the lobster meat.
In a separate small saucepan, melt the dairy-free margarine or plant-based butter over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1-2 minutes. Stir in parsley, lemon juice, lemon zest, and chives, then remove from heat.
Place the lobster tails, shell side down, onto the preheated grill. Cover and cook for 10-12 minutes or until the lobster meat is opaque and firm. Baste occasionally with the melted garlic herb mixture.
Remove the lobster tails from the grill and drizzle with any remaining garlic herb butter.
Serve immediately with additional lemon wedges on the side, if desired.
